== Noticeable Differences ==

*Sound effects for the [[weapons]] differ significantly, as do the visual effects used during their firing. They make longer laser-like streaks and noises instead of the short-round plasma blasts.

*Halo is depicted as having an assortment of native wildlife.

*The [[Banshee|Banshees]] depicted have tail flaps that act as a rudder for aerial steering.

*A [[Elite Major|Major Elite]] uses the [[Energy Sword]] to kill one of the [[Marines]].  However, that particular rank never uses the sword in the final version. An [[Elite Minor|Minor Elite]] was also seen wielding the Energy Sword.

*The [[Assault Rifle]] used by the Marines appears to have a wood finish on various parts.

*The Marines are depicted to be much more efficient in combat than the Final game would prove. Their armor and color of uniform differs slightly, and their "scouter" eyepiece is red, instead of green.
